My Epson XP605 printer has not been printing properly for some time. It also will not copy doing it manually The problem with it printing in general only partially printing and of poor quality. Today the only thing it would print was a nozzle check which seemed OK I note that there are 5 inks one being photo black but only 4 inks print out on nozzle check. Despite not printing the ink levels have gone down by a good margin.
I then deleted the printer and and reinstalled it on both the desktop and the laptop. It will now print from the laptop but it will still will not copy when I try to do it manually. The paper is totally blank . Any idea of what the problem may be. I have tried to look at the guide to see whether it could throw any light on the matter.
I have spent so much time today but wondered if anyone can offer me any advice.
